Tin Siding Installation Questions
What types of projects typically require tin siding installation? Tin siding is often used for updating or replacing existing siding on residential and commercial buildings, including barns, sheds, and home exteriors.
Is tin siding suitable for all climate conditions? Yes, tin siding is durable and can withstand various weather conditions, making it a practical choice for properties in different climates.
What are the benefits of choosing tin siding for a property? Tin siding offers a long-lasting, low-maintenance exterior that provides good resistance to pests, rot, and fire.
What should property owners consider before installing tin siding? It's important to assess the existing structure, ensure proper insulation, and select the right style and color to match the property's aesthetic.
